Definition

A capacitor is an electronic component that stores electrical energy in an electric field. Think of it as a tiny rechargeable battery, but it releases energy much faster. It's used in circuits to filter signals, store energy temporarily, and smooth out voltage fluctuations. Unlike a resistor, it doesn't dissipate energy as heat.
